Indirect calorimetry in critically ill mechanically ventilated patients: Comparison of E-sCOVX with the deltatrac.
Indirect calorimetry is recommended to measure energy expenditure (EE) in critically ill, mechanically ventilated patients. The most validated system, the Deltatrac® (Datex-Ohmeda, Helsinki, Finland) is no longer in production. We tested the agreement of a new breath-by-breath metabolic monitor E-sCOVX® (GE healthcare, Helsinki, Finland), with the Deltatrac. We also compared the performance of the E-sCOVX to commonly used predictive equations. ⋯ The E-sCOVX metabolic monitor is not accurate in estimating EE in critically ill mechanically ventilated patients when compared to the Deltatrac, the present reference method. The E-sCOVX overestimates EE with a bias and precision that are clinically unacceptable.

Sarcopenia is known to be a poor prognostic factor after liver transplantation (LT). However, the significance of obesity in combination with sarcopenia (sarcopenic obesity) remains unclear. This study examined the impact of sarcopenic obesity on outcomes after living donor LT (LDLT). ⋯ Patients with sarcopenic obesity showed worse survival after LDLT compared with nonsarcopenic/nonobesity patients.
